Alpine Wetlands

· · · Bidding Closes 5/16/25 at 10:00 AM MT · · · 
Project Description:
Location:
The project consists of replacing a headgate on the Salt River; regrading of the headgate area and downstream Coot Ditch; replacing a road culvert; armoring five reservoir spillways; and replacement of a water control structure. Specifically, three concrete headwalls are to be poured with two screwgates installed on the upstream two headwalls. 60 linear of feet of concrete pipe (ranging from 36” to 48” diameter) will be installed between the headwalls with drill stem reinforcement included. The headgate area will be reconfigured and regarded with a total excavation/placement of 1,613 CY. The downstream inlet channel is to be regraded with a total cut of 1,230 CY. The existing culvert is to be replaced at the road crossing with a 45’ long aluminum box culvert. Five total reservoir spillways are to be armored with a total of 105 CY of DU Class II rock riprap. One water control structure will be replaced on the Goldeneye Reservoir which includes 52 linear feet of SDR 51 PVC pipe install and 4 CY of DU Class II rock riprap. Project work also includes a dewatering effort at the headgate, traffic control and maintenance at the road culvert, and removal and off-site disposal of existing pipe and water control structures. There will be a site showing on Thursday, May 1st at 10:00 am (See Notice to Bidders).
The project is located in Lincoln County, Wyoming. It is approximately 3.5 miles south of the town of Alpine, WY.

Grand Valley Audubon Center Endangered Fish Ponds

· · · Bidding Closes 5/09/25 at 2:00 PM MT · · · 
Project Description:
Location:
The project consists of excavating 5,719 C.Y. of material constructing a ditches, regrading a wetland and building up an embankment. The project includes the installation of a concrete Fish Kettle, Concrete Channel with Rubicon Flume Gate, 2 – screw gates, square manhole, with 38 L.F. of 2’x3’ concrete pre-cast box culverts, 2 -90 degree concrete box culvert bends, 80 L.F. of 24” 16-guage corrugated metal pipe, 14 L.F. 24” dual wall HDPE pipe, 98 C.Y. of DU Class II rock riprap w/ filter fabric, 80 C.Y. of 1/4" Minus Gravel w/ Filter Fabric, 150 C.Y. of 1/2" Minus Gravel w/ Filter Fabric, 38 C.Y. of 1/2" Minus Gravel, of 24 C.Y. of 2” Drain Rock Bedding, 2,020 S.F. of 6” Thick Geocells, a removal of a walking bridge and a 2” 18-guage lockable road gate and their associated materials, which will be supplied and installed by the contractor. All work shall be completed with plans and specifications developed by Ducks Unlimited, Inc.
This project is located in Mesa County, CO approximately 3 miles west of Grand Junction, CO.
